The Wiltshire Councillors will consider applications to the Community Area Grants Scheme, as follows (copies attached):
i. Vine for PAT - Supportive accommodation for deprived and socially excluded potentially homeless, pregnant or abused,teenagers - requested £4,729.
ii. Bradley Gardens Residents Association - Installation of Rubbish/Dog Mess bins – requested £924.
iii. Trowbridge Town Council - Cultural Olympiad Dance Festival - requested £2,500.
iv. Friends of Biss Meadows Country Park - Purchase Tools, Equipment & Safety Wear - requested £1,000.
v. Longmeadow Tenants And Residents Association - Purchase equipment for Community Engagement & Youth Activities - requested £1,000.
vi. Trowbridge Pub and Club Watch - Provision and Monitoring of the Towns Pubwatch Radio system - requested £5,000.
vii. West Ashton Village Hall and Institute - Fitting of photovoltaic panels to village hall - requested £5,000.
Total requested = £20,153.
Allocation of Grant Funding to date:
Trowbridge Annual Festival of Fun - £5,000
Trowbridge Town Council – Enhancement of Christmas lights - £5,000
Trowbridge Town Council – Provision of dropped kerbs around Trowbridge town - £5,000
Trowbridge Museum – Provision of holiday activity - £1,300
Trowbridge Community Area Future – Trowbridge Neighbourhoods Partnership - £1,000
BA14 Culture Group - £4,900
Trowbridge Town Council – Christmas Fair - £1,000
To date £23,200 has been allocated from the Community Area Grants Scheme budget of £42,676 for 2009/10 leaving a remainder of £19,476 for allocation.
Minutes:
Councillors were asked to consider 6 new applications and 1 deferred application seeking 2009/10 Community Area Grant Funding:
Debbie Vaughan addressed the Area Board on behalf of the Bradley Gardens Residents Association.
James McDonald addressed the Area Board on behalf of the Friends of Biss Meadows Country Park.
James McDonald addressed the Area Board on behalf of the Longmeadow Tenants and Residents Association.
Ron Pybus addressed the Area Board on behalf of the West Ashton Village Hall and Institute.
Decision
The application from VINE for PAT that requested £4,729 was refused.
Reason
The application did not meet the Community Area Grant Criteria for 2009/10.
Decision
The application from Bradley Gardens Residents Association for the installation of Rubbish/Dog Mess bins that requested £924 was deferred.
Reason
Wiltshire Council Waste Service Officers to undertake an inspection of the local area and any other possible funding can be sourced from Wiltshire Council.
Decision
Trowbridge Town Council was awarded £2,500 for the Cultural Olympiad Dance Festival.
Reason
The application met the Community Area Grant Criteria for 2009/10.
Note: Cllrs H Osborn and J Osborn abtained from the vote.
Decision
Friends of Biss Meadows Country Park was awarded £561 to purchase tools, equipment and safety wear. £439 for litter bins and fittings was deferred.
Reason
The application met the Community Area Grant Criteria for 2009/10.
Reason
Wiltshire Council Waste Service Officers to undertake an inspection of the local area and any other possible funding sources from Wiltshire Council.
Decision
Longmeadow Tenants and Residents Association was awarded £1,000 to purchase equipment for Community Engagement & Youth Activities.
Reason
The application met the Community Area Grant Criteria for 2009/10.
Decision
Trowbridge Pub and Club Watch was awarded £5,000 for provision and monitoring of the Towns Pub watch Radio system.
Reason
The application met the Community Area Grant Criteria for 2009/10.
Decision
West Ashton Village Hall and Institute was awarded £5,000 for fitting of photovoltaic panels to village hall.
Reason
The application met the Community Area Grant Criteria for 2009/10.
